Apple’s Stronghold in Japan
Apple’s Stronghold in Japan
According to a recent IDC report, Apple has not only maintained but also expanded its market share in Japan.
In the final quarter of the last year, Apple’s market share surged to 51.9%, marking a significant lead over its nearest competitor, Sharp, which held a mere 10.9% share.
Apple captures over 50% market share in Japan’s smartphone sector
This growth signifies Apple’s continuing dominance in the Japanese smartphone market, capturing more than half of all smartphone sales within the country.
The strength of Apple’s brand and product lineup has evidently resonated well with Japanese consumers, allowing it to maintain a commanding lead.
Facing Headwinds in China
iPhone sales experience a 24% drop in China early 2024.
Contrastingly, the situation in China presents a starkly different scenario.
The beginning of 2024 has been particularly challenging for smartphone brands, with the market experiencing a 7% drop in the first six weeks, as noted by Counterpoint Research.
This period, spanning from January 1 to February 11, witnessed double-digit declines in shipments for several brands, including Apple, which saw a 24% decrease compared to the previous year.
Factors such as low consumer confidence and a paucity of high-profile launches have been identified as key contributors to the sluggish start.

How is the performance of nothing phone (2a)?
Performance
Phone (2a)’s Dimensity 7200 Pro processor has been exclusively co-engineered with MediaTek to deliver the best performance with optimal power efficiency.
Built on TSMC’s latest second-generation 4nm process technology, Phone (2a) effortlessly powers through any task with unparalleled power efficiency and blazing speed.
Paired with an expansive 20 GB RAM with RAM Booster technology, the 8-core chip – clocking speeds up to 2.8 GHz – ensures swift and responsive multitasking all day long. This results in a performance that is 13% more powerful than Phone (1) and 16% more efficient.
Together, Nothing and MediaTek have introduced optimisations such as Smart Clean (+200% UFS read/write speed over prolonged usage) and Adaptive NTFS (+100% file transfer speeds with Windows computers) and have been able to reduce power consumption of specific components by up to 10%.
How is the Battery and Charging of nothing phone(2a)?
At 5,000 mAh, Phone (2a) contains Nothing’s smartphone biggest battery to date, delivering up to two days of use on a full charge. Not only is it larger, it also performs better. From Phone (1), Nothing has increased battery longevity by over 25%.
This means it can maintain over 90% of its maximum capacity after 1,000 charging cycles, corresponding to over three years of daily charging. The battery also has a 13% reduction in temperature when charging and discharging compared to Phone (1), which contributes to its longevity.
For rapid power-ups, Phone (2a) supports 45W Fast Charging, delivering 50% of power in just 20 minutes. An optimal charging solution that avoids the risk of depleting battery life, often related to higher watt count and charging speeds.
How is the Camera of nothing phone (2a)?
For capturing life’s greatest hits, Phone (2a) features a flawless dual 50 MP rear camera that’s powered by our TrueLens Engine.
The TrueLens Engine is a series of advanced computational algorithms that come together to ensure every shot taken on Phone (2a) is as close to real life as possible.
This includes Ultra XDR, which has been co-developed with Google to ensure a more accurate display of highlights and shadows in every shot.
It works by capturing 8 frames at different exposure levels in RAW format, and then adjusting the brightness of each pixel up to 5 times to display the most true-to-life result.
For landing the perfect selfies anytime, anywhere, Phone (2a) has an exceptional 32 MP front camera that uses the same sensor as Phone (2), which has 27% more light sensitivity versus Phone (1) and enables more details to come through.
How is the Display of Phone (2a)?
Phone (2a) has a 6.7” flexible AMOLED display, which means it can deliver stunningly accurate colour reproduction of 1.07 billion colours while minimising battery consumption.
Also, with a peak brightness of 1,300 nits, Phone (2a) delivers an uncompromised viewing experience even in the brightest outdoor conditions.
With a refresh rate of 120 Hz, Phone (2a) provides sublimely smooth interactions that dynamically adapts to the content displayed. This goes down to 30 Hz for videos and still to preserve battery.
Phone (2a) features the thinnest bezels in Nothing’s smartphone line-up, measuring just 2.1 mm symmetrically on all four sides of the screen.
This achievement results in an impressive screen-to-body ratio of 91.65%, made possible through the combination of a flexible panel with structural engineering improvements.
How is the Design of Phone (2a)?
Phone (2a) is the ultimate representation of Nothing’s unique design expression. In fact, it embodies the first-ever internal smartphone design concept that was created all the way back in 2020, a few months after Nothing launched.
With Phone (2a), by placing the cameras inside the NFC coil, Nothing has created a new product icon: the eyes. Behind these is the hub of intelligence that powers the phone, much like a brain.
Phone (2a) features an industry-first with its 90° angle unibody cover wrapping around the edges to create a new dimension and perspective to Nothing’s design, while seamlessly integrating the dual camera module. Not only is this structure aesthetically pleasing, it makes the device sturdier, with a notable improvement on drop test results.
Adding to the cohesion between form and function, the unique camera ‘bump’ also plays a role in stabilising the phone when it’s lying flat on a surface as well as helping minimise finger obstructions when taking a picture.

How is Phone (2a) focussed on Sustainability?
Phone (2a) delivers Nothing’s lowest carbon footprint in a smartphone. At 52 kg, it’s 12.5% lower than that of Phone (1). With sustainability goals in mind, Nothing has developed a brand-new recycling process in Nothing’s manufacturing plant, which allows for plastic waste from the Ear (2) production line to be repurposed into Phone (2a).
Nothing has also maintained its commitment to plastic-free packaging, using recycled fibre instead. The device itself also contains a number of recycled materials:
● 100% recycled aluminium used in the mid frame ● 100% recycled tin on 6 circuit boards ● 100% recycled copper foil on the main circuit board ● Recycled steel on 22 steel stamping parts ● Over 50% of the plastic parts are sustainably sourced

This rebranding strategy involves transitioning the name of its 2nd generation 3nm-class fabrication technology from SF3 to SF2, aligning its naming convention more closely with industry standards, and positioning itself against rivals like Intel Foundry.
Official confirmation from Samsung that it will call its new manufacturing process, “2nm”.
Samsung’s process technology roadmap, revealed in late 2022, highlights a progression through various nodes, including SF3E, SF4P, SF3, SF4X, SF2, SF3P, SF2P, and SF1.4.
Samsung Electronics’ change of process name may be beneficial to OEM marketing.
The change from SF3 to SF2, communicated to customers since early 2024, necessitated contract revisions for those committed to utilizing the SF3 production node.
Samsung has been at the forefront of semiconductor innovation
“We were informed by Samsung Electronics that the 2nd generation 3nm [name] is being changed to 2nm,”shared a source with ZDNet, highlighting the contractual adjustments required to accommodate this naming shift.
Despite the change in designation, Samsung’s commitment to innovationremains steadfast, with plans to commence chip production using the newly termed SF2 technology by the second half of 2024.
Technological Implications and Future Roadmap
Renaming renaming of its second-generation 3nm process to “2nm” can be seen as a strategic move
Samsung’s SF2 technology, originally known as SF3, incorporates gate-all-around (GAA) transistors, specifically Multi-Bridge-Channel Field Effect Transistors (MBCFET).
“Samsung Electronics’ second-generation 3nm (2nm) process design kit (PDK) has been released, so if Samsung rushes into mass production this year, they will be well-positioned to do so. As for the specific mass production time, it depends largely on customer requirements” said a semiconductor insider to ZDNet.
Samsung Foundry rebrands 2nd generation 3nm technology to SF2
Notably, the SF2 technology does not feature a backside power delivery network (BSPDN), positioning it at a competitive disadvantage relative to Intel’s 20A process, which integrates both GAA transistors and BSPDN for enhanced performance and energy efficiency.

The version 11.4 update brings a focused approach to minimizing distractions by restricting access to specific apps while the vehicle is in motion, signifying a major step towards Android Auto’s “Don’t phone and drive” policy.
Streamlining In-Car App Usage
Streamlining In-Car App Usage
The update introduces a visual cue for apps that are restricted while the car is moving.
These apps will now feature a small “P” icon located at the bottom right corner on the home screen, indicating they are only accessible when the vehicle is parked.
However, exceptions are made for electric vehicle owners who can enjoy apps like GameSnacks, designed for touchscreen interaction, during charging periods.
By making these limitations clear,Android Auto enhances its user interfaceand makes a safer driving environment, preventing attempts to engage with certain apps while on the move.
How many of us will actually follow it, remains to be seen.
Focusing on Driver Attention
Focusing on Driver Attention
Furthering its commitment to road safety, Android Auto now offers a feature to manage lengthy text messages.
With the goal of reducing driver distraction, the system will now summarize texts longer than 40 words, while shorter messages will be read aloud in their entirety.
This functionality ensures that drivers can stay informed without diverting their attention from the road to their screens.
However, users are advised to approach the summarization cautiously, as the condensed version of messages may not fully capture the original text’s essence.
Although the summarized messages provide a quick glance at the content, checking the complete message when safely parked remains advisable for a comprehensive understanding.

While the chipset market includes heavyweights like Apple, Google, Qualcomm, Unisoc, and Samsung, MediaTek distinguished itself not just in terms of units shipped but also in its remarkable year-on-year growth.
Dominating the Market with Impressive Growth
The analysis revealed Mediatek powered more devices than any chip maker in the final quarter of last year, with a 21% increase YoY.
The Q4 2023 report by Canalys reveals that MediaTek successfully shipped an impressive 117 million units, far outpacing Apple’s 78 million and Qualcomm’s 69 million.
This not only showcases MediaTek’s dominance in terms of volume but also its substantial 21% year-on-year growth in shipments, alongside a 22% increase in revenues to $23 billion.
Mediatek, Apple, and Qualcomm were the top three chipset providers across the market, while Huawei-owned HiSilicon saw $7 billion in revenue for 7 million units.
Despite this monumental achievement, MediaTek’s financial gains still fell short of its competitors, with Apple generating a staggering $87 billion and Qualcomm $30 billion in revenue over the same period.
Nonetheless, MediaTek’s performance is noteworthy, especially when contrasted with Samsung’s Exynos brand, which saw a 44% plunge in its earnings, hinting at a preference for MediaTek and Qualcomm chips in Samsung devices during the quarter.
Market Dynamics and Rising Stars
Samsung Semiconductor saw a 48% decrease in shipments of phones with an Exynos chip, bringing down the quarterly revenue to $5 billion, 44% down from last year.
In contrast, Samsung was MediaTek’s biggest customer, despite the wide reach of MediaTek’s chips across various brands including Xiaomi, Vivo, and OPPO.
An interesting subplot in the report is the performance of Unisoc, a company that exhibited a robust 24% year-on-year growth in both revenues and shipments, albeit from a smaller base.
Unisoc’s success is predominantly attributed to partnerships with Transsion brands, alongside Realme and Lenovo, indicating a strong presence in the budget smartphone sector.
Google’s Tensor chips, exclusive to the Pixel series, showed relatively modest shipments and revenue, reflecting the niche market share of Pixel smartphones.
In terms of revenue, it is Apple that took the crown in Q4 2023.

Now available on the mobile application and gradually making its way to the web platform, this innovative addition allows users to have responses read out loud, enhancing the interactive experience.
OpenAI states: “ChatGPT can now read responses to you. On iOS or Android, tap and hold the message and then tap “Read Aloud”. We’ve also started rolling on web – click the “Read Aloud” button below the message.”
On iOS or Android, tap and hold the message and then tap “Read Aloud”. We’ve also started rolling on web – click the “Read Aloud” button below the message. pic.twitter.com/KevIkgAFbG
— OpenAI (@OpenAI) March 4, 2024
Users have control over the playback through a convenient toolbar, which offers functions to pause, resume, navigate backward or forward by 15 seconds, or cease playback entirely.
Accessing previous conversations for auditory playback is straightforward.
Navigate through past discussions by tapping the menu icon and selecting a conversation of interest.
Pressing down on a response and choosing “Read Aloud” will revive the dialogue in auditory form.
Customization extends to the voice delivering the content.
